With his wife Lillian and a friend in San Damiano, Italy, they compiled their favorite prayers, took them to a local printer and had 1,000 copies made.<\/p>\n<p>Eventually all the books were given away and they made the decision to print more. They realized that they would have to charge a small fee for the book to offset the printing and shipping costs. To keep the cost as low as possible, Harry asked at the post office, &#8220;What&#8217;s the cheapest way to ship this?&#8221; &#8220;Book rate (media mail),&#8221; replied the postmaster, &#8220;but in order to be considered a book, it must have at least 72 pages.&#8221; They opened the Pieta book and it had exactly 72 pages!
